Night sky September 2026 brings a fascinating selection
of sights and events for UK observers. As the nights begin to draw in,
September offers two comets, two lunar occultations, the autumn equinox,
Neptune at opposition and plenty of opportunities to follow the planets
across the sky.
There are also plenty of opportunities to follow the planets as they
move through the September sky.
🔭 September at a Glance
- Comet 161P/Hartley–IRAS – brightening during September
- Comet 10P/Tempel 2 – challenging but worth looking for
- 8 September – the Moon occults the Beehive Cluster, M44
- 14 September – lunar occultation of Venus
- 23 September – autumn equinox
- 26 September – Neptune reaches opposition
The Comets of September
Two comets provide interesting challenges this month:
161P/Hartley–IRAS and 10P/Tempel 2.
Both can be observed with modest astronomical equipment under suitable
conditions, although a dark sky and a good star atlas or planetarium
application will make finding them considerably easier.
What do comet names mean?
A name such as 161P/Hartley–IRAS contains useful
information. The number identifies it among numbered periodic comets,
while the letter P tells us that it is a periodic
comet. The remainder of the name normally recognises the discoverer
or discoverers — in this case Hartley and the IRAS mission.
Comet 161P/Hartley–IRAS
Comet 161P/Hartley–IRAS provides an interesting target during September.
The comet was discovered in 1983 and carries the names of Malcolm Hartley
and IRAS, the Infrared Astronomical Satellite.
During the month it can be followed as it moves through
Eridanus and Cetus, continuing towards
Aquarius as we move towards early October.
For UK observers it remains relatively low in the sky, so finding a
location with a clear horizon will help.
At the beginning of September it is expected to be around magnitude
+12.1, brightening during the month towards approximately
+9.7.
One way to begin looking for it in early September is to locate
Tau Eridani and use a detailed star chart to follow the
comet’s movement towards Cetus.
Because a comet changes position against the background stars from one
night to another, this is an excellent object to return to repeatedly
during the month.
Comet 10P/Tempel 2
Our second comet is 10P/Tempel 2.
The number 10 tells us that it was the tenth periodic comet to receive a
permanent number, while the name honours astronomer
Wilhelm Tempel.
This is a difficult object for UK observers because it remains very low
in the sky. Under a clear, dark sky and with suitable equipment, however,
experienced observers may be able to follow it as it moves through
Piscis Austrinus.
Don’t be disappointed if you cannot find it. Low altitude means we are
looking through considerably more of Earth’s atmosphere, which can make
already faint objects much harder to see.
What Does Magnitude Mean?
Astronomers use magnitude to describe how bright an
object appears. The scale can seem backwards at first:
the lower the magnitude number, the brighter the object.
An object at magnitude +1 is therefore much brighter than one at
magnitude +6. Particularly bright objects can even have negative
magnitudes.
8 September – The Moon Occults the Beehive Cluster
During the early morning of 8 September, the Moon passes
in front of the open star cluster M44, better known as
the Beehive Cluster, in the constellation Cancer.
This type of event is known as a lunar occultation.
From our viewpoint the much nearer Moon appears to pass in front of the
more distant stars.
For UK observers the event begins at around
04:00 BST (03:00 UT) and continues towards dawn.
As morning twilight increases, some of the cluster’s fainter stars will
become more difficult to see.
This could also provide an interesting photographic opportunity.
⚠️ Solar Safety Warning
Some of this month’s events occur during twilight or daylight when
the Sun may be above or close to the horizon.
Never sweep the sky with binoculars or a telescope when the
Sun is nearby. Accidentally allowing direct sunlight into
unfiltered binoculars, a telescope or finder scope can cause
permanent eye damage or blindness. If you cannot locate an object
safely, do not attempt the observation.
14 September – The Moon Occults Venus
Another unusual observing and photographic opportunity occurs on
14 September, when the Moon passes in front of
Venus.
This is a daylight event for UK observers, which makes it considerably
more challenging.
The precise disappearance and reappearance times vary according to your
location, so check an up-to-date astronomy application or occultation
prediction for where you live before attempting the observation.
Venus is extremely bright and can be seen through a telescope in
daylight under suitable conditions, but locating anything through optical
equipment when the Sun is above the horizon requires particular care.
If you are inexperienced with daytime telescope observing, it is better
to miss the event than risk accidentally pointing optical equipment
towards the Sun.
The Planets
Mercury
Mercury is poorly placed for UK observers during September and remains
too close to the Sun to make it a worthwhile observing target.
Venus
Venus is also poorly placed for conventional observing during much of
the month, although its occultation by the Moon on 14 September provides
one of September’s most unusual events.
Mars
Mars begins September in Gemini before moving into
Cancer later in the month.
On 6 and 7 September a waning crescent Moon lies nearby, creating an
attractive pairing.
Mars shines at around magnitude +1.2 during the month.
Jupiter
Jupiter is a morning planet during September and can be
found in Cancer.
A thin waning crescent Moon lies nearby on the mornings of
8 and 9 September, providing another attractive sight
for early risers.
Saturn
Saturn is another morning planet, shining at around magnitude
+0.5 at the beginning of September.
It is located around the Pisces/Cetus region during the month and becomes
increasingly well placed as September progresses.
Uranus
Uranus shines at approximately magnitude +5.7 in
Taurus.
Although technically close to the naked-eye limit under exceptionally
dark conditions, binoculars or a telescope and a good chart make finding
it considerably easier.
Neptune
Neptune reaches opposition on 26 September.
At opposition a planet lies opposite the Sun in our sky, meaning it rises
around sunset and remains visible for much of the night. This makes
opposition one of the best times to observe a distant planet.
Neptune is far too faint to see with the naked eye, so you’ll need
binoculars or, preferably, a telescope and a good star chart to identify it.
Moon Phases – September 2026
Following the Moon through its phases is one of the easiest ways to begin
regular observing.
- Last Quarter: 4 September
- New Moon: 11 September
- First Quarter: 18 September
- Full Moon: 26 September

23 September – The Autumn Equinox
September also marks the beginning of astronomical autumn in the Northern
Hemisphere.
The autumn equinox occurs on 23 September, when the Sun
crosses the celestial equator.
For observers in the UK, it also signals something astronomers have been
waiting for throughout the summer:
longer nights.
As September progresses, darkness arrives earlier and gives us more time
to explore the night sky.
